Transaction 5dd7790a588f6003d9813cabaac866089d5437020ef0c3779cd2c8c3e4e03f78
1 Input
1 Output
-
5dd7790a588f6003d9813cabaac866089d5437020ef0c3779cd2c8c3e4e03f78:0
- value
- 37807460
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28e1a99f0f93a272b238a3891bb7699002443599 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14jAMz6TwwnKuaeCnZB6sGMMjwiZcrW1ew